Edgewood Middle School students back in class after false alarm evacuation

(photo supplied / Warsaw Community Schools)

Edgewood Middle School was briefly evacuated Friday morning.

Students were taken to Washington STEM Academy as NIPSCO & the Warsaw-Wayne Fire Department investigated a report of a gas smell. They say there was not a gas leak present.

At 8:40 a.m. staff and students were given the all clear to re-enter the building.

Warsaw Community Schools Superintendent Dr. David Hoffert tells News Now Warsaw they were using an abundance of caution and he is thankful to first responders for their quick and diligent response.
